How they compare
Croatia currently reports 527,831 against 514,432 in Finland, a difference of 13,399.
Across all 8 years both countries report, Croatia has been ahead every year.
Croatia ranks 79th and Finland ranks 80th of 214 countries.
Croatia has averaged higher in every one of the 4 decades both report.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Croatia | Finland |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1990s | 574,762 | 81,492 | 493,270 | Croatia |
| 2000s | 582,286 | 164,186 | 418,100 | Croatia |
| 2010s | 567,170 | 271,668 | 295,502 | Croatia |
| 2020s | 527,944 | 450,242 | 77,702 | Croatia |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.

About this data
International migrant stock, total is the number of people at mid-year born in a country other than that in which they live. It also includes refugees.
